The two spacecraft, making up the Integrated Payload Stack, weighed 5,190 kg at liftoff, and were separated 15 hours, 36 minutes (EUTELSAT 5 WestB and 15 hours, 54 minutes (MEV-1) after liftoff. Operators at the Northrop Grumman operations centre in Dulles, Virginia acquired the spacecraft’s first telemetry from orbit shortly after separation.
EUTELSAT 5 West B is a Ku-band satellite that will be located at 5° West, a key video neighbourhood addressing predominantly French, Italian and Algerian broadcast markets. The new satellite will provide business continuity and improved quality for these markets via a Ku band payload of 35 equivalent 36 MHz transponders connected to three service areas. Switchable transponders will also increase commercial flexibility.
MEV-1 will deliver a groundbreaking on-orbit servicing satellite life-extension through Northrop Grumman’s wholly-owned subsidiary SpaceLogistics LLC. MEV-1 will dock to client vehicles in geosynchronous orbit to provide attitude and orbit control of the combined vehicle stack. MEV-1 has the ability to dock and undock several times during its 15 year design life, allowing it to service multiple customers. SpaceLogistics LLC’s initial service, using MEV-1, will extend the life of the Intelsat 901 satellite for five years.

5° West a short History of this satellite position,
Stellat 5, as it was originally known, was built by Alcatel Space on behalf of Stellat, a joint-venture between France Telecom (70%) and Europe*Star (30%), a subsidiary of Alcatel Space and Loral Space and Communications. It was launched 5 July 2002 at 23:21 UTC by an Ariane 5 G rocket from Guyana Space Centre along with the Japanese satellite N-STAR c. It had a launch weight of 4,050 kilograms (8,930 lb). Victim of financial difficulties, France Télecom withdrew from space operations. In this move it sold Stellat to Eutelsat in July 2002. Early 8 October, the satellite entered operational service.

Eutelsat completed the acquisition for a sum of €183,900,000 and renamed the satellite Atlantic Bird 3.

AB 3 took on the role covered by the satellites Telecom 1 and 2 C, operational between 1983 and 2002, in the historic French position of 5° longitude West. In March 2012 Eutelsat re-baptised its satellite fleet, and AB 3 was renamed Eutelsat 5 West A.

Probably there is no payload that need testing. This was in yesterday's FCC report for several US earth stations:
On October 8, 2019, Intelsat License LLC was granted special temporary authority for 30 days, beginning October 9, 2019, to operate its
Fillmore, CA earth station to provide launch and early orbit phase (LEOP) and TT&C services to MEV-1 (S2990) satellite during: (1) the
spacecraft's LEOP period; (2) MEV-1's docking with Intelsat 901 (S2405) satellite at 300 km above the geostationary arc; (3) the drift as a
combined vehicle stack (CVS) with Intelsat 901 satellite from 300 km above the geostationary arc to 27.5° W.L.; and (4) as the CVS on-station
at 27.5° W.L. on the geostationary arc on center frequencies: 5924.00 MHz, 5927.50 MHz, 6170.00 MHz, and 6180.00 MHz (Earth-to-space);
and 3698.00 MHz, 3944.50 MHz, 3955.50 MHz, and 4199.80 MHz (space-to-Earth).

TT&C for Eutelsat 5 West B was also mentioned: 12501.0 MHz, 12502.0 MHz, 11198.8 MHz, and 11199.8 MHz (LHCP)
